Stitzel-Weller is hallowed ground for bourbon enthusiasts. Opened on Derby Day 1935 by Julian "Pappy" Van Winkle Sr., this is the distillery that produced Old Fitzgerald, W.L. Weller, Rebel Yell, Cabin Still, and the legendary Pappy Van Winkle line. The names that echo through these rickhouses represent bourbon royalty. Now owned by Diageo, the distillery was reopened to the public in 2014 and the tour focuses heavily on history — which is exactly what makes it special. You'll walk the gorgeous, manicured grounds, step inside a working rickhouse, and see the cooperage where barrels are repaired. The campus has a beautifully curated feel that's distinct from other Louisville stops. The tasting features Diageo's current portfolio including Blade & Bow, I.W. Harper, Bulleit, and Orphan Barrel. The Garden & Gun Club upstairs offers cocktails and small plates in a refined lounge setting — it's worth lingering after your tour. Fair warning: some bourbon purists wish the tour leaned harder into the Van Winkle/Weller history rather than focusing on current Diageo brands. But the grounds themselves tell that story if you know where to look. Located in Shively, about five miles from downtown Louisville — it's a quick detour from the Whiskey Row distilleries.

Book online 1–2 weeks ahead for weekends. Weekday tours are easier to snag. Limited tour capacity means walk-ups can be turned away, so don't chance it — especially during peak bourbon season (May–October).

The gift shop carries Blade & Bow, I.W. Harper, Bulleit, and Orphan Barrel bottles plus unique merchandise. Prices tend to be higher than Louisville liquor stores — you're paying for the experience of buying at the source. Look for distillery-exclusive bottlings.
